What is a Shipping Container?
Shipping containers are standardized, long lasting, and stackable boxes developed for the storage and transport of items. They are generally made from steel and be available in several sizes, consisting of the basic 20-foot and 40-foot containers. These containers are essential for the intermodal transport system that combines several modes of transport, consisting of ships, trucks, and trains.

Shipping container providers play an important role in the overall logistics supply chain. They are associated with different functions, consisting of the production, sourcing, and circulation of shipping containers. Here are a few of the essential roles they carry out:

Manufacturing and Sourcing: Suppliers manufacture containers in numerous specs or source them from manufacturers. They make sure quality control to adhere to worldwide shipping standards.

Sales and Leasing: Many providers use both sales and leasing options, permitting companies to choose the very best suitable for their operational needs. This versatility is particularly essential for business with fluctuating storage and transport requirements.

Custom Modifications: Some suppliers provide custom modifications, such as adding insulation, windows, or custom shelving, to fulfill specific needs. This is particularly useful in sectors like construction and retail.

Repurposing and Resale: Used shipping containers are often readily available for resale. Providers recondition and repurpose these containers for numerous applications, decreasing expenses and ecological waste.

Delivery and Logistics: Shipping container providers often manage the logistics of delivering containers to customers, which can consist of coordinating with freight providers and handling transport schedules.
